Hmmm. My rankings probably don't match most Civ-fans, but I'd put it
in third place, between Civ2 and Civ4. But I'm the oddball who loves
the original 1991 game most of all the versions.
My Civilization Rankings:
Civilization 1 (1992)
Civilization 4 (2006)
(Alpha Centauri) (1999)
Civilization 2 (1996)
Civilization 5 (2010)
Civilization 3 (2004)
I left out "Civilization 6" (2016) because, as mentioned in an earlier
post, I can't really remember much about it. If pressed, I'd probably
slot it between Civ3 and Civ5. "Civilization 7" (2025) is similary
excluded simply because I haven't played it yet.
"Alpha Centauri" (or, as I often think of it in my head, "Alpha Civ")
had a lot of things I liked about it. The fact that it wasn't set on
Earth was a very welcome change; the new setting and ideas were quite
well implemented. But the gameplay (and to some degree, the visuals)
just weren't quite as engaging. In some ways, the game was just TOO
alien for me to immerse myself in like I did with the other games in
the series. So, yes; I loved it because it was different, and hated it
for the same reason ;-P
But I'd like to give a shout-out to "Civilization Revolution", at
least the IPad version; although a cutback and very obviously
made-for-mobile game, it captured the feel of Civilization quite well.
It's much shallower than the other Civ games, but it's made so you can
finish a campaign fairly quickly (in a matter of hours, not days or
weeks). It would probably get a spot between 2 and 5.
